Talent Consultant – Regional Support

Full time, ongoing

Catholic Education Western Australia (CEWA Ltd)

Based in West Leederville

Are you an experienced recruiter who is ready to ditch arbitrary KPIs and focus on what truly matters… meaningful relationships, exceptional service, and high-quality outcomes for schools and candidates?

This brand-new role offers the chance to have a genuine impact in regional WA communities while working as part of a tight knit, supportive team.

The Role

We are seeking a motivated and relationship driven Talent Consultant to provide recruitment support to Catholic school Principals across regional locations in the Geraldton, Perth and Bunbury Dioceses.

You will work closely with school leaders to understand their unique contexts, proactively build regional talent pipelines, and deliver an exceptional candidate and hiring manager experience from start to finish.

Key responsibilities include:

* Developing a deep understanding of each school community and its staffing needs
* Building trusted relationships with Principals and stakeholders across WA
* Leading end to end recruitment processes and maintaining high governance standards
* Proactively sourcing teachers and support staff for rural and regional settings
* Enhancing CEWA's employer brand through strong communication and candidate care
* Supporting CEWA's strategic directions and commitment to child safety

For detailed accountabilities and criteria, see the Talent Consultant Position Description: PD & SC Talent Consultant

What You'll Bring

* End to end recruitment experience
* A genuine passion for people, teamwork and service
* Strong communication, stakeholder engagement and problem-solving skills
* Ability to manage competing priorities while maintaining high quality standards
* An understanding of (or openness to) the Catholic ethos within CEWA
* Experience working with regional or remote communities is highly regarded

About Us

Catholic Education Western Australia (CEWA) represents over 150 schools across the state and is committed to providing outstanding education grounded in community, inclusion and service. Our People and Culture team plays a key role in supporting school leaders to attract and retain high calibre staff for both metropolitan and regional communities.
